The name Cheikh (sometimes spelled Sheikh or Shaykh) originates from Arabic شيخ (shaykh), meaning 'elder' or 'leader.' It historically refers to a position of authority, wisdom, and respect within Arab and Islamic communities. The term has traditionally been used as a title for tribal leaders, Islamic scholars, or men of notable age and wisdom who hold positions of leadership.
Beyond its function as a title, Cheikh has evolved to become a given name in many Arabic-speaking regions, as well as in parts of Africa, particularly in countries with significant Islamic influence such as Senegal and Mali. The name carries connotations of dignity, leadership qualities, and spiritual guidance, reflecting the cultural importance placed on wisdom and community leadership in these societies.

The name Cheikh, of Arabic origin, has gained prominence across various cultures and geographical regions, particularly in West Africa and the Arab world. In its original Arabic form, it is spelled 'Sheikh' or 'Shaikh,' denoting a respected elder, tribal leader, or Islamic scholar. Regional variations include the Francophone spelling 'Cheick,' common in Mali and other French-influenced West African countries. In East Africa, particularly Somalia, you might encounter 'Sheekh,' while Persian communities often use 'Shaykh.' The Urdu variant 'Shaik' is widespread in South Asia, and Turkish speakers may use 'Şeyh.' These spelling variations reflect the name's journey across different languages and writing systems while maintaining its core meaning of respect and authority.
